Joshua Tree & Palm Springs 🚗 Day Trip Guide 🌵✨
🚗 Departure & Route • It’s best to depart from Los Angeles before 6:30 AM to beat the traffic and heat. • Suggested route: LA → Joshua Tree (West Entrance) → Palm Springs → Return to LA • Total driving time is around 5–6 hours (excluding stops and exploration). 📍 Itinerary Morning: Joshua Tree National Park 1. Joshua Tree Visitor Center • Grab a map and refill your water here. 💧 2. Hidden Valley Nature Trail • A classic 1-mile loop—perfect for photos among giant rocks and Joshua trees! 📸 3. Skull Rock • A fun roadside landmark—easy to access and great for quirky photos. 💀 4. Keys View • A high lookout point with sweeping views of Coachella Valley and the San Andreas Fault. • If you prefer a relaxed pace, you can wrap up here and head to Palm Springs. ⏰ Time spent: About 4 hours Noon: Head to Palm Springs • Drive time approx. 45 minutes. • Lunch in downtown Palm Springs—highly recommend: • Cheeky’s – Famous brunch spot, known for their bacon flight! 🥓 • Sherman’s Deli & Bakery – Classic American deli with huge sandwiches! 🥪 Afternoon: Palm Springs Highlights 1. Palm Springs Aerial Tramway 🚠 • The world’s largest rotating tramcar! Ascend to the top of Mount San Jacinto for cool temps and breathtaking views. • Easy walking trails at the summit. 2. Palm Springs Walk of Stars & Downtown • Stroll through downtown—admire retro architecture, art galleries, and cozy cafés. 3. Palm Springs Windmills • See the wind farm along I-10 on your way back—or join a 1-hour guided windmill tour! 🌬️ ⏰ Time spent: About 4 hours Evening: Return to Los Angeles • Drive back takes around 2 hours. You can enjoy dinner in Palm Springs before heading home. 🛠️ Helpful Tips • Park Fee: Joshua Tree is $30 per vehicle. • What to Wear: It’s sunny in Joshua Tree and can get hot in Palm Springs—wear sunscreen and light layers. Bring a jacket for the tram; it can be cool up top! • Water: Carry plenty of water—Joshua Tree is dry and hot. • Cell Service: Spotty in Joshua Tree—download offline maps ahead of time!
